Patent №: 11874722 (January 16, 2024) –Applying modern standby configurations on a per-application basis.

This invention allows for the dynamic application of Modern Standby configurations to specific applications within a system transitioning into Modern Standby mode. Through the use of job objects or other suitable structures, selected Modern Standby configurations can be applied, replicating Modern Disconnected Standby or suspension for certain applications while the system remains in Modern Standby.

Julia J Brown

Executive Vice President, Chief Technical Officer at Universal Display Corporation.

Since joining UDC in 1998, Dr. Brown has spearheaded the R&D vision of the Company, from its start-up years to its successful commercial present, and continues to create and shape the Company’s innovation strategy for its future growth.

Dr. Brown is an elected IEEE Fellow, elected SID Fellow, and inductee into the New Jersey High Tech Hall of Fame. In 2020, the Society for Information Display (SID) awarded Dr. Brown the prestigious Karl Ferdinand Braun Prize for her outstanding technical achievements and contributions to the development and commercialization of phosphorescent OLED materials and display technology.

In 2021, Dr. Brown was elected to the U.S. National Academy of Engineering (NAE) for her contributions to materials and device technologies for phosphorescent light emitting diode displays, and their commercialization.

Patent №: 11877489 (January 16, 2024) – High color gamut OLED displays. This invention introduces a three-subpixel per pixel red/green/blue (RGB) architecture, as well as a fascinating four-subpixel approach known as the R1R2GB (red/red/green/blue). These innovative techniques have the potential to revolutionize the visual impact of OLED displays.

Patent №: 11875346 (January 16, 2024) – Enhanced mobile wallet payment elements. Maeng introduces a method to issue store credit electronically to a mobile wallet application from a merchant. This credit is provided in the form of an enhanced wallet payment element that encompasses terms and conditions, such as repayment terms, embedded within a digital contract.

Patent №: 11874160 (January 16, 2024) – Systems and methods for utilizing machine learning to minimize a potential of damage to fiber optic cables, focuses on analyzing sensing data collected from fiber sensor devices. The machine learning model processes this data, assessing the threat level posed to the cable by identifying various attributes like vibration signal amplitudes, frequencies, patterns, times, and corresponding locations.

Patent №: 11873707 (January 16, 2024) – Rate of penetration optimization for wellbores using machine learning.

image 114

This patent describes a system and method for controlling a drilling tool inside a wellbore by projecting optimal rates of penetration (ROP) and controllable parameters such as weight-on-bit (WOB) and rotations-per-minute (RPM). The system employs data generation models, including non-linear, linear, recurrent generative adversarial network (RGAN), and deep neural network models, to predict and optimize drilling parameters.

Patent №: 11873671 (January 16, 2024) – Method for controlling door movements of the door of a motor vehicle, and motor vehicle component.

This patent describes a sophisticated control system for motor vehicle doors, utilizing a combination of control devices, sensor arrangements, and motion influencing devices. By accurately capturing distance data with a built-in distance sensor, the system can determine the position of objects around the door wing, thereby enhancing safety and facilitating an optimized door operation.
